    Does anyone know if the DRL are wired with the fog lights? We just noticed ours don’t work and the only thing I can think of is 2 years ago I disconnected the factory harness and ran my own wires to the fog lights so I could just turn them on. By disconnecting the factory fog lights did I then make the DRLs not work? Thank you for any responses.

    There is an option to turn off the daytime running lights in the setup menu. (Under general or vehicle, I can’t remember which). It overrides the position on the stalk. You might want to check it.
